It would be nice to have an llTakeObject function, or some way for a script to take a rezzed object into the parent object's inventory.

I would also like to see a CloneObject command. It works exactly like RezObject but clones the current object, instead of rezing one from inventory. I've been writing fractal trees and a clone function would come in mighty handy.
